Texas EquuSearch’s State-of-the-Art Marine Sonic Sonar Unit
Posted on 03. Nov, 2011 by smckinney.
11/03/11 — While working with law enforcement in an undisclosed location, Team Watters, our sonar experts, located a car with remains inside using the Texas EquuSearch Marine Sonic Sonar System. The remains have been identified, and the person has been missing since 2008. The location of the find will remain undisclosed to protect the investigation [...]

Two Recoveries Made by Texas EquuSearch’s Sonar Experts
Posted on 24. Aug, 2011 by smckinney.
08/24/11 — Dennis and Tammy Watters, Texas EquuSearch’s sonar experts, with the help of our new Marine Sonic sonar equipment, found a drowning victim in the Dallas area on August 23, 2011, who was recovered by divers. On August 24, 2011, a vehicle was recovered that had been missing since 2008, and had human remains inside. [...]
